Yoko Sweater
Yōko is a female Japanese given name. Depending on the kanji used in writing it, it can have meanings including “Free Child” (暢子), “Sunny Child” (陽子), “Glorious Child” (容子), “Ocean Child” (洋子), “Leaf Child” (葉子), etc. (Wikipedia.org).
The name reflects the free spirit and bohemian feeling of the sweater. Different patchwork style textured rectangles mimic the versatile vibes of the nature.
Level: Advanced
Sizes: XS S; M; L
Bust: 30” 34”; 38”; 42”
76 cm 86cm; 96cm; 106cm
Materials:
Yarn weight: light worsted CYCA #4
Color A – white – 7 7;8;8 skeins
Color B – brown – 1 skeins
Color C – beige/sand – 1 skeins
Color D – light pink – 1 skein
Crochet Hook:
10 / J (6 mm). Adjust hook size if necessary to obtain correct gauge.
7 mm. Adjust hook size if necessary to obtain correct gauge.
Gauge:
4”/10 cm = 11 rows = 12 sts in hdc with smaller hook.
4”/10 cm = 9 rows = 10 sts in hdc with larger hook.
Skills needed:
Previous experience in making different kind of cables, popcorns.
Previous experience in garment making.
Previous experience in colorwork.
